What we will cover today…
• Where is the camera on my phone?• Taking a photo• Zoom in and out• Deleting a photo• Where do my photos go to?• Viewing my photos• Sending a photo to someone else (multimedia message)
• Accessing the Video Recorder• Stop or pause recording• Where are my videos gone?• Sending video clips via Multimedia or Bluetooth

Press Menu button to view menu options
Press right arrow key to select Media
Press Menu (middle button) again to select/open Media
Where is the camera? ...Media

1) First option listed is Camera…just press Menu to activate it!
2) Point camera at object you want to take photo of– do not cover lens on back of phone with your finger!
3) Press middle button to ‘Capture’ the photo
Taking a Photo

Zoom in and out
Press the up and down arrows to zoom in and out

Deleting a Photo
If you are not happy with the photo, you can delete it straight away…
Just press the middle button to delete
Press middle button again to confirm deletion

Where are my photos gone?
They are in your Gallery!
Return to your Home screen
Press the Menu button
The Gallery is in the middle of the screen and can be opened by pressing the middle button
Press the middle button to open the Images folder and view your photos

Viewing Photos
Your photos are listed with a preview of each image on the left side of the screen
Press the middle button on any photo to open it
Use the Back button to go back to your list of photos
Use up and down arrows to select a different photo

Sending a Photo
This is a photo that has been opened
Note that it says Send on the screen…
To send the photo to someone, just press the middle button!

Sending a Photo
You will then see this screen – you need to click the middle button to Add the person you want to send the photo to from your Contacts list or you can simply type in a phone number in the To box
Note: This is similar to when you were adding a name when sending a text message!
The photo is already included in your message here

Use the down arrow to go to Contacts
Press the middle button to open the Contacts folder
Use the up/down arrows until you find the person you want to send the photo toPress the middle button to select this person
Sending a Photo
![Page 12: Mobile Phone Training Level 3](https://reader036.fdocuments.in/reader036/viewer/2022062721/568138a8550346895da06869/html5/thumbnails/12.jpg)
You can add text in the Text box
Press middle button to send…the message here would then be sent to John
And the picture being sent here is a photo of the computer mouse which was saved as Image001.jpg (this name was given automatically!)

Accessing the Video Recorder
Open the Media icon as we did earlier – press Menu button, move right and press Menu button again
Here you can use Video as well the camera – press middle button on Video
Press middle button to start recording

Stop or Pause Recording
Pause – press middle button
Stop – press top right button (blue line)

Where are my videos gone?
Remember where you looked to find your photos – almost the exact same for videos!!They are in your Gallery!
Return to your Home screenPress the Menu button
Press the middle button to open Gallery
Instead of opening Images…move down to Video Clips and press middle button

Sending a Video Clip
To send a video clip, select the video clip
Press the top left button (blue line) to view the available Options for that video clip
Use the down arrow to move down to the Send option
Press the middle button to select Send

We will look at sending the message via:1)Multimedia
- This is the screen you will see – click Send
- Follow same instructions as for photos earlier – add name from Contacts list and send!
2) Bluetooth- type of technology- FREE to use!!- must be near receiver’s phone

Sending a Video Clip via Bluetooth
•Select Via Bluetooth•Searching for devices appears on screen•If other Bluetooth devices are within range are switched on they will appear on screen as ‘Devices found’•Press Select (middle button) if you want to choose a device•You will see message where it says Connecting to…

•Receiver will see message on left and must accept before message can be sent
•Once Receiver says Yes to above message, it will say Sending file on Sender’s screen•A message appears saying Item sent when it has completed
